Loading...San Francisco address2502 Park Lane San Francisco California 01775 US(709) 618-8793 x9479 Loading...Loading... Loading...More winery near you849 Laguna Canyon Rd, Laguna Beach, California, 92651, United States 680 Rossi Rd, St Helena, California, 94574, United States 7000 CA-128, Philo, California, 95466, United States 3059 Willow Ln, Westlake Village, California, 91361, United States People also viewed1480 64th St STE 100, Emeryville, California, 94608, United States 4111 Broadway, Oakland, California, 94611, United States 4038 Martin Luther King Jr Way, Oakland, California, 94609, United States 5679 Bay St, Emeryville, California, 94608, United States